Bitcoin is retesting a vital 0.85 cost-basis band round $109,000 that has traditionally served as a key turning level for the digital asset’s worth actions, in response to on-chain analytics from Glassnode.
Traditionally, holding above this degree has triggered main rallies, whereas dropping beneath it typically results in a decline towards the 0.75 band, close to $98,000.
The retest comes as Bitcoin navigates a mid-cycle consolidation part supported by macro liquidity tailwinds and ETF-driven demand. Latest analyses spotlight Bitcoin’s formation of parabolic curve patterns, which sign potential for prolonged upward developments if key help ranges maintain.
